Friends feud

CHICAGO — A federal court in Illinois dismissed one of 12 claims brought by a man against his former friend, who allegedly engaged in a monthslong campaign to manipulate and gaslight the man and his boyfriend, to the point of accessing their electronic devices without permission and attempting to convince them of infidelity in the relationship. Only a negligent supervision claim is dismissed; the intentional tort and privacy violation claims will proceed.
